Portuguese

sudeste

Etymology

From French sud-est (southeast), from sud (south) + est (east).

Pronunciation

  • (Brazil) IPA(key): /su.ˈdɛs.t͡ʃi/, /su.ˈdɛʃ.t͡ʃi/
  • (South Brazil) IPA(key): /su.ˈdɛs.te/
  • (Portugal) IPA(key): /su.ˈðɛʃ.tɨ/
  • Homophone: Sudeste
  • Hyphenation: su‧des‧te

Noun

sudeste m (uncountable)

  1. southeast (compass point)
